Rajasthan: In the early hours of Friday morning, residents of Jaipur were jolted awake by a series of earthquakes, causing panic and concern across the city. The National Centre for Seismology (NCS) reported three separate quakes, with the first one striking at 4:09 am, measuring a magnitude of 4.4. Following the initial tremor, two more earthquakes were felt in Jaipur. The second quake, registering a magnitude of 3.1, hit at 4:22 am, and the third, measuring 3.4, occurred at 4:25 am. According to NCS data, the epicenter of the first earthquake was at a shallow depth of 10 kilometers. The subsequent tremors added to the anxiety of residents who felt the ground shake. The seismic activity prompted many people to rush out of their homes in fear, seeking safety in open spaces. There have been no immediate reports of casualties or significant damage.
